Umbilical granuloma in 1month old baby
How long does it take umbilical cord stamp to heal? My baby is 1month old still umbilical area not fully dry ,still slight wetness will be there.23 days back slight bleeding was observed in navel and doctor suggested apply neoasiprin power for 3days ,we are applying neoaspirin from past 20days bleeding is not present but navel area is still wet .is it normal?if so by when it can become completely dry ??
